  • Notes 
    • 1911 RG14 27193 101 at 12 Nineveh View Holbeck Leeds grandson in the household of Dibb Pitts single aged 1 born Holbeck
      Ancestry UK Outward Passenger Lists 1890-1960 5 Apr 1912 Port of Departure: Liverpool England Destination Port: St John New Brunswick Canada Ship Name: Corsican Shipping Line: Allan Line Official Number: 124191 Master: E Cook
      George was coming back from Montreal/Quebec Canada to Liverpool arrived 31st July 1913 on ship Tunisian. Steerage passenger child aged 3 Counrty of last permenant residence Canada. Noted as Halliday
      1939 Register 535/2 JFPD 67 at 21 Easterside Middlesbrough CO male married draughtsman at industrial furnace & steel works DOB 1st Feb 1910
